#402727 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#402727 is composed of 25.1% red, 15.3%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.1% magenta, 39.1%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 24.3% and a lightness of 20.2%. #402727 color hex could be obtained by blending #804e4e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#402727 color description : Very dark desaturated red.
#402727 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#402727 has RGB values of R:64, G:39,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.39,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 4204327.
